    Who is Dr. Gurskis, Specialist in Long Beach, CA?

    Dr. John Gurskis, MD is a Specialist, who primarily practices in Long Beach, CA with 1 additional practice location. He is board certified. Dr. Gurskis completed his residency at Univ Ca Davis Med Ctr, Anesthesiology; Rush-Presby-St Luke'S M C, General Surgery. Dr. Gurskis is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Gurskis’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.
